Introduction

Sugarcane bowls, made from bagasse, the fibrous by-product of the sugarcane extraction process, are rapidly gaining popularity as a sustainable packaging alternative. These bowls have multiple applications in various industries due to their eco-friendly nature and excellent performance characteristics.

Uses of Sugarcane Bowl

Food Packaging

Sugarcane bowls are predominantly used in the food industry for packaging purposes. Owing to their ability to withstand heat, they are ideal for both hot and cold food items. The bowls are often employed by restaurants, fast-food outlets, and catering services. They serve as an excellent substitute for polystyrene and plastic containers, which are known to be non-biodegradable.

Sustainability Advantages

Being derived from renewable materials, sugarcane bowls offer significant sustainability benefits. They are produced from bagasse, which would otherwise contribute to agricultural waste. Annually, approximately 54 million metric tons of bagasse are generated worldwide, offering a tremendous resource for sustainable production.

Compostability

Sugarcane bowls are compostable under industrial composting conditions, breaking down within 60 to 90 days. This feature contributes to waste reduction and minimizes environmental impact. Within appropriate facilities, 90-95% of the material biodegrades within the composting period.

Performance Characteristics

Durability

Sugarcane bowls exhibit robust durability, withstanding pressure and weight during handling and transportation. They possess a tensile strength comparable to conventional plastic containers, ensuring they retain shape and functionality during use.

Thermal Properties

The thermal resilience of sugarcane bowls allows them to endure temperatures up to 220°F (104°C) without deformation, making them ideal for microwaving purposes. The insulation capacity ensures that the contents remain warm, offering a functional advantage for food service providers.

Moisture Resistance

Coated with a natural moisture-resistant layer, sugarcane bowls prevent leakage and maintain the integrity of both the container and its contents. Through application of a plant-based wax or chemical-free treatment, these bowls successfully contain liquids and semi-liquid food items.
